Jump to content 日本-日本語

製品  >  ソフトウェア  >  HP-UX 

AIXからHP-UX 11iへのアプリケーションの移行支援

HP-UX 11iによるITインフラストラクチャモダナイゼーションで将来を見据えた環境を実現
HP-UX/Integrityサーバー お問い合せ
コンテンツに進む
AIXからHP-UX 11iへのアプリケーションの移行支援

HP-UX 11iは、Integrityサーバーにおいて最新のバージョンを使用することで、そのビジネス価値が最も早期に実現されます。
ITインフラストラクチャのモダナイゼーションによって「将来を見据えた環境」が構築され、現在お使いのクリティカルアプリケーションが新しいバージョンになってもその機能やメリットを十分に活用できるようになります。
AIXからHP-UX 11iへのアプリケーションの移行支援
HP-UX 11iによるITインフラストラクチャモダナイゼーションで将来を見据えた環境を実現
AIX to HP-UX 11i Porting Kit (AHPK)
AIX Software Transition Kit (AIX STK)
関連ページ/ドキュメント

HP-UX 11iによるITインフラストラクチャモダナイゼーションで将来を見据えた環境を実現

AIXからHP-UX 11iへの移行概要図
図1:AIXからHP-UX 11iへの移行概要図

新機能

HPでは2つの移行キットを用意し、AIXからHP-UX 11iへのアプリケーションの移行を支援しています。AIX Software Transition Kit (AIX STK) とAIX to HP-UX 11i Porting Kit (AHPK) が、移行のアセスメント、プランニング、および自動化を強力にサポートします。
AIX STKは、AIXアプリケーションをHP-UX 11iに移行する際に必要な作業を、AHPKで実現できる自動化レベルと合わせて即座に予測します。
このAHPKは、ほぼシームレスかつ100%自動でAIXアプリケーションをHP-UX 11iに移行します。

AIX to HP-UX 11i Porting Kit (AHPK)

機能およびメリット

AIX to HP-UX 11i Porting Kit (AHPK) は、AIXからHP-UX 11iへの移行に使用する大企業向けの移植環境で、HP-UXソリューションのTCOの削減にも役立ちます。
移行時にお客様が苦労しなくてすむようにとHPが取り組んだ結果生まれたのが、このAHPKです。AHPKは、構築環境、およびAIXとHP-UX 11iにおけるAPIの違いを特定し、自動的にそれらに対処します。この自動化により、HP-UX 11iでのAIXアプリケーションの起動と実行に必要な時間と作業が大幅に削減されます。

機能概要

移行作業を予測
AHPK内のスキャナーがCおよびC++ソースをスキャンし、HP-UX 11iへの移行に必要なすべての変更を洗い出します。また、AHPKで自動化できる変更を特定します。

ツールセットの違いに対応
HPコンパイラのコンパイラツールオプションはAIXコンパイラのものとは異なります。また、lnやmkdirなどのツールでサポートされているオプションも異なっています。AHPKでは、これらのオプションをAIXからHP-UX 11iに置き換えるドライバープログラムを提供します。

APIの違いに対応
HP-UX 11iのAPIの多くは、AIXのAPIとは使用方法やパラメーターが異なっており、一部のAIX APIはHP-UX 11iに対応していません。AHPKはこれらの違いに対応する移行環境を提供します。

makefileの変更に対応
AIXからHP-UX 11iへ移行する場合、makefileを手作業で修正して構築環境の違いに対応する必要があります。そこでAHPKでは、そのような変更を最小化するmakeツールを提供しています。

上記のように、AHPKは、ほぼシームレスかつ100%自動のAIXアプリケーションのHP-UX 11iへの移植を実現しています。

AIX Software Transition Kit (AIX STK)

ビジネス上のメリット

HP Software Transition Kitには、HP-UX 11iの旧バージョンから新バージョン、Tru64 UNIXからHP-UX 11i、SolarisからHP-UX 11i、LinuxからHP-UX 11iへの移行に役立つツールやドキュメントが含まれています。

テクノロジーの優位性

AIX STKを使用する最大のメリットの1つが、AIXアプリケーション移行時の迅速な作業予測です。また、HPのAIX移行ツールキット (AIX to HP-UX 11i Porting Kit) で実現できる自動化レベルも提供します。
AIX to HP-UX 11i STKは、お客様が持つ以下のような疑問を解決します。
  • AIXからHP-UX 11iにソフトウェアを移行するにはどうすればよいのか?
  • HP-UX 11iの最新リリースの新機能はどのようなもので、それらをどのように活用すればよいのか?
  • 現在使用しているソフトウェアの32ビット版または64ビット版は必要なのか?

機能およびメリット

  • AIX Software Transition Kit (STK) は、AIXアプリケーションをインテル® Itanium® プラットフォーム上のHP-UX 11i環境へ移行する際に役立つツールやドキュメントをまとめたものです。
  • AIX STKは、わかりやすい手法でコード分析を行い、スキャンしたAIXソースコードに出現する各APIに関して的確なアドバイスを提供します。
  • 開発者によるAIXとHP-UX 11i間の互換性の問題の特定および解決を支援し、AIXオペレーティングシステムからIntegrityサーバーへのソフトウェアの移植を大幅に簡素化します。またSTKには、ホワイトペーパー、ベストプラクティス、使用ガイド、および移植ガイドなどの、開発者向けのドキュメントが多数用意されています。

機能概要

STKは以下で構成されています。
  • 一連のファイルスキャンツール  米国のサイトへと関連のデータベースおよび情報。ソースファイル、makefile、移行時に問題となる可能性のある拡張子のスクリプトをチェックします。またこれらのツールは、HP-UX 11iの拡張機能の使用機会も特定します。
  • 参照ドキュメントおよび移植ガイドのライブラリ。その他の参照ドキュメントや移植に関する情報は、アプリケーション移行Webサイト  米国のサイトへで参照できます。
  • マンページ (リファレンスページ) またはHP Webサイト上のマンページへのリンク
  • 主要なページ、影響、ドキュメントを検索する検索エンジン

関連ページ/ドキュメント

Solaris Software Transition Kitツール  米国のサイトへ
Solaris Software Transition Kitドキュメント  米国のサイトへ

お問い合わせ

ご購入前のお問い合わせ


ご購入後のお問い合わせ

オンラインサポート
製品の標準保証でご利用いただける無償のサービスです。

ショールーム

ショールーム 導入をご検討のお客様へ
業務アプリケーションの継続・標準化・開発性とシステム担当者様、システム開発者様が抱える悩み・疑問に対する解決策実体験して頂けます。

このページのトップへ戻る
印刷用画面へ
プライバシー ご利用条件・免責事項